In DAOC the server was split into three separate factions. The player base was fully divided. On any given night Dark Age of Camelot Platinum my server had about 1500-2000 players online. Break this number down by three and you are looking at between 500 and roughly 633 players per realm. When you crossed over into PvP you suddenly faced off against the other two factions. Not every player was in PvP though and there were about 6-8 RvR zones that you could explore to hunt for other players. This break down seemed to balance the game nicely.
